Types of Office Furniture

Office furniture creates an optimal work environment by blending comfort and functionality. Below are the different areas in an office and the ideal types of furniture to make each space more productive and engaging.

1. Employee Workspace

The employee workspace is the hub of daily productivity. The Productivity furniture here includes ergonomic chairs and height-adjustable desks.

  • Ergonomic Chairs: These chairs are designed with adjustable backrests, headrests, and seat depths to ensure comfort during long work hours. Lumbar support is crucial for maintaining good posture and preventing back strain.
  • Height-Adjustable Desks: These desks allow employees to alternate between sitting and standing, significantly improving focus and reducing fatigue. Custom height options enable employees to work in their most comfortable position, boosting overall productivity.

2. Meeting Workspace

Meetings and conferences are critical to team collaboration, and the furniture in these spaces should encourage participation and engagement.

  • Meeting Tables: Choose sturdy, minimalistic conference tables that provide ample space for group discussions. Rectangular or oval tables are ideal for more formal settings, while round tables work well for smaller, informal meetings.
  • Ergonomic Chairs for Meeting Rooms: Like employee workstations, meeting spaces benefit from adjustable and comfortable seating. Chairs that are easy to maneuver and adjust will make meetings more efficient and enjoyable.

3. Vibrant Lounges for Breaks

The lounge area is important in recharging employees and fostering informal communication. Breaks are essential for maintaining productivity, and productivity in this space should reflect comfort and relaxation.

  • Couches and Coffee Tables: Soft, inviting couches paired with sleek coffee tables create a welcoming space for employees to relax, socialize, or even hold informal meetings.
  • Lounge Chairs: Comfortable and stylish chairs that employees can use to help create a relaxing atmosphere, improving their mood and readiness to work after a break.

4. Client Waiting Workspace

Your office’s reception or waiting area is the first space your clients encounter, and it’s crucial to make a lasting impression. The right furniture in this area reflects the professionalism and competence of your business.

  • Reception Desks: A well-organized and visually appealing reception desk will set a welcoming tone for visitors.
  • Comfortable Seating: Chairs or sofas in the waiting area should be relaxed and aesthetically aligned with the company’s brand. Ergonomic seating with soft cushioning and armrests enhances the client’s waiting experience.

5. Modular Furniture for Flexibility

Flexibility is key in dynamic work environments. Modular furniture allows offices to be reconfigured easily based on changing needs without the hassle of purchasing new furniture.

  • Modular Desks and Workstations: These pieces can be arranged and re-arranged to suit the size of teams or specific projects. Modular furniture grows and evolves with your business, whether you need a solo desk or a collaborative benching system.

6. Storage Solutions

Even in today’s digital world, physical storage remains essential for keeping workspaces organized and efficient.

  • Filing Cabinets and Shelves: Ensure your office has sufficient storage solutions for important documents, supplies, and personal items. Vertical storage systems help save floor space while keeping the office clutter-free.
